  • Super Mario 3D World Revealed for Wii U – E3 2013

    Nintendo’s 3D Mario for Wii U now has a name: Super Mario 3D World. During its pre-E3 2013 Nintendo Direct, the publisher highlighted EAD Tokyo’s next project, which draws heavy inspiration and design elements from its last game – Super Mario 3D Land for Nintendo 3DS. 3D World is due out in December 2013.

  • Evander Holyfield’s “Real Deal” Boxing review for Sega Genesis

    If you’ve ever thought you had the goods to be a professional fighter, now’s your chance to find out with Evander Holyfield Boxing for the Sega Genesis.

    Create your own boxer from scratch, deciding on everything from his name to his hairstyle to the color of his trunks. As you train your boxer, develop his strength, stamina, speed, and defense in order to give him a chance when he finally steps into the ring. When you feel like your man is ready, try to work your way up the ranks against 28 different opponents, and maybe even earn a shot at the only man to win the Heavyweight Title four different times, Evander Holyfield. With Evander Holyfield Boxing, the sweet science has never been sweeter.

  • Defiance Gameplay MMO for PC, Xbox 360 & PS3

    Defiance is the first multi-platform shooter MMO, that in a ground-breaking entertainment experience, interconnects with a global television program on Syfy.

    The game combines the intense action of a console 3rd person shooter, with the persistence, scale, and customization of an MMO, while its TV counterpart exudes the scope, story, and drama of a classic sci-fi epic. 30 years in the future, where the world is trying to survive after a massive War took place between Humans and Aliens. Now the survivors on Earth must work together to survive the attacks and try to rebuild their world…

  • HELLFIRE review for Sega Genesis

    Classic Game Room reviews HELLFIRE for Sega Genesis released in 1990 by Toaplan and Seismic! This insanely hard side scrolling space ship shooter (or SHMUP) is for those looking for a serious, SERIOUS challenge! Bump anything and die. Get shot and die. Crash into a shot into a bump into die and die. Hard levels and that chunky Sega Genesis style make this a cool game but really frustrating with R-Type checkpoints and power ups that cause you to speed and die.   • Classic Game Room HD – GALAXY FORCE 2 for Sega Genesis

    Classic Game Room was the FIRST classic video game review show on the Internet in 1999. Returning in 2008 with new episodes, Classic Game Room breaks out a review of GALAXY FORCE 2 for the Sega Genesis Megadrive 16-bit video game console. The Mega Drive has a number of space related games and first person shooters, Galaxy Force 2 is an arcade port from the arcade machine.

    This retro old school classic video game allows you to pilot a spaceship through space and fight robots, mecha, mechs and a variety of enemy alien bad guys. Made by Sega, Galaxy Force 2 is a science fiction based fps first person shooter style with a space ship flying through the stars. Do you like Space Harrier, Omega Boost or Project Sylpheed? Then this game might be for you. We didn’t think it was one of the best Genesis cartridges but it could have been worse.

  • YAKUZA DEAD SOULS review for PS3

    Classic Game Room reviews YAKUZA DEAD SOULS for PlayStation 3 from Sega, wild zombie survival game combined with numerous odd minigames, ping pong and Karaoke! CGR Yakuza Dead Souls video review has gameplay from Yakuza Dead Souls on PS3 showing zombie slaughtering action and massage parlor weirdness in HD glory. Mow down zombies and level your Yakuza bad guy good guys up with new movies and earn money to upgrade the minigun and shotgun into a serious arsenal of doom. Yakuza Dead Sould is like Dead Rising meets GTA meets Sega’s quirky arcade style seen in games like Chu Chu Rocket and even Shenmue. Yakuza Dead Souls packs hours of gameplay into this massive adventure filled with side quests and hostess dating (yeah, meet a virtual girlfriend and eat some virtual fried chicken!). Fun characters, solid gameplay, good humor and a cool storyline make Yakuza Dead Souls another hit from Sega in 2012. This game belongs on your shelf in between Binary Domain and Vanquish.

  • The Magical Quest Starring Mickey Mouse for the Super Nintendo

    Video game review of The Magical Quest Starring Mickey Mouse for the Super Nintendo by Capcom. Disney’s iconic rodent embarks on a sidescrolling adventure full of magic and fantasy as he tries to rescue his dog Pluto from the evil Emporer Pete. To spice up the usual platforming action, Mickey can also put on various costumes with new abilities, taking the role of magician, firefighter, or mountain climber. Varied gameplay and good range of difficulty make this a solid platformer with graphics and sound to match Disney’s classic storybook atmosphere.
